2019-12-13 16:37:25 +03:00
<domainCapabilities >
<path > /usr/bin/qemu-system-x86_64</path>
<domain > kvm</domain>
<machine > pc-q35-5.0</machine>
<arch > x86_64</arch>
<vcpu max= '288' />
<iothreads supported= 'yes' />
<os supported= 'yes' >
<enum name= 'firmware' >
<value > bios</value>
<value > efi</value>
</enum>
<loader supported= 'yes' >
<value > /usr/share/AAVMF/AAVMF_CODE.fd</value>
<value > /usr/share/AAVMF/AAVMF32_CODE.fd</value>
<value > /usr/share/OVMF/OVMF_CODE.fd</value>
<enum name= 'type' >
<value > rom</value>
<value > pflash</value>
</enum>
<enum name= 'readonly' >
<value > yes</value>
<value > no</value>
</enum>
<enum name= 'secure' >
<value > yes</value>
<value > no</value>
</enum>
</loader>
</os>
<cpu >
<mode name= 'host-passthrough' supported= 'yes' />
<mode name= 'host-model' supported= 'yes' >
<model fallback= 'forbid' > Skylake-Client-IBRS</model>
<vendor > Intel</vendor>
<feature policy= 'require' name= 'ss' />
<feature policy= 'require' name= 'vmx' />
<feature policy= 'require' name= 'hypervisor' />
<feature policy= 'require' name= 'tsc_adjust' />
<feature policy= 'require' name= 'clflushopt' />
<feature policy= 'require' name= 'umip' />
<feature policy= 'require' name= 'md-clear' />
<feature policy= 'require' name= 'stibp' />
<feature policy= 'require' name= 'arch-capabilities' />
<feature policy= 'require' name= 'ssbd' />
<feature policy= 'require' name= 'xsaves' />
<feature policy= 'require' name= 'pdpe1gb' />
<feature policy= 'require' name= 'invtsc' />
<feature policy= 'require' name= 'skip-l1dfl-vmentry' />
</mode>
<mode name= 'custom' supported= 'yes' >
<model usable= 'yes' > qemu64</model>
<model usable= 'yes' > qemu32</model>
<model usable= 'no' > phenom</model>
<model usable= 'yes' > pentium3</model>
<model usable= 'yes' > pentium2</model>
<model usable= 'yes' > pentium</model>
<model usable= 'yes' > n270</model>
<model usable= 'yes' > kvm64</model>
<model usable= 'yes' > kvm32</model>
<model usable= 'yes' > coreduo</model>
<model usable= 'yes' > core2duo</model>
<model usable= 'no' > athlon</model>
<model usable= 'yes' > Westmere-IBRS</model>
<model usable= 'yes' > Westmere</model>
2020-03-10 13:48:06 +03:00
<model usable= 'no' > Skylake-Server-noTSX-IBRS</model>
2019-12-13 16:37:25 +03:00
<model usable= 'no' > Skylake-Server-IBRS</model>
<model usable= 'no' > Skylake-Server</model>
2020-03-10 13:48:06 +03:00
<model usable= 'yes' > Skylake-Client-noTSX-IBRS</model>
2019-12-13 16:37:25 +03:00
<model usable= 'yes' > Skylake-Client-IBRS</model>
<model usable= 'yes' > Skylake-Client</model>
<model usable= 'yes' > SandyBridge-IBRS</model>
<model usable= 'yes' > SandyBridge</model>
<model usable= 'yes' > Penryn</model>
<model usable= 'no' > Opteron_G5</model>
<model usable= 'no' > Opteron_G4</model>
<model usable= 'no' > Opteron_G3</model>
<model usable= 'yes' > Opteron_G2</model>
<model usable= 'yes' > Opteron_G1</model>
<model usable= 'yes' > Nehalem-IBRS</model>
<model usable= 'yes' > Nehalem</model>
<model usable= 'yes' > IvyBridge-IBRS</model>
<model usable= 'yes' > IvyBridge</model>
2020-03-10 13:48:06 +03:00
<model usable= 'no' > Icelake-Server-noTSX</model>
2019-12-13 16:37:25 +03:00
<model usable= 'no' > Icelake-Server</model>
2020-03-10 13:48:06 +03:00
<model usable= 'no' > Icelake-Client-noTSX</model>
2019-12-13 16:37:25 +03:00
<model usable= 'no' > Icelake-Client</model>
<model usable= 'yes' > Haswell-noTSX-IBRS</model>
<model usable= 'yes' > Haswell-noTSX</model>
<model usable= 'yes' > Haswell-IBRS</model>
<model usable= 'yes' > Haswell</model>
<model usable= 'no' > EPYC-IBPB</model>
<model usable= 'no' > EPYC</model>
<model usable= 'no' > Dhyana</model>
<model usable= 'yes' > Conroe</model>
2020-03-10 13:48:06 +03:00
<model usable= 'no' > Cascadelake-Server-noTSX</model>
2019-12-13 16:37:25 +03:00
<model usable= 'no' > Cascadelake-Server</model>
<model usable= 'yes' > Broadwell-noTSX-IBRS</model>
<model usable= 'yes' > Broadwell-noTSX</model>
<model usable= 'yes' > Broadwell-IBRS</model>
<model usable= 'yes' > Broadwell</model>
<model usable= 'yes' > 486</model>
</mode>
</cpu>
<devices >
<disk supported= 'yes' >
<enum name= 'diskDevice' >
<value > disk</value>
<value > cdrom</value>
<value > floppy</value>
<value > lun</value>
</enum>
<enum name= 'bus' >
<value > fdc</value>
<value > scsi</value>
<value > virtio</value>
<value > usb</value>
<value > sata</value>
</enum>
<enum name= 'model' >
<value > virtio</value>
<value > virtio-transitional</value>
<value > virtio-non-transitional</value>
</enum>
</disk>
<graphics supported= 'yes' >
<enum name= 'type' >
<value > sdl</value>
<value > vnc</value>
<value > spice</value>
</enum>
</graphics>
<video supported= 'yes' >
<enum name= 'modelType' >
<value > vga</value>
<value > cirrus</value>
<value > vmvga</value>
<value > qxl</value>
<value > virtio</value>
<value > none</value>
<value > bochs</value>
<value > ramfb</value>
</enum>
</video>
<hostdev supported= 'yes' >
<enum name= 'mode' >
<value > subsystem</value>
</enum>
<enum name= 'startupPolicy' >
<value > default</value>
<value > mandatory</value>
<value > requisite</value>
<value > optional</value>
</enum>
<enum name= 'subsysType' >
<value > usb</value>
<value > pci</value>
<value > scsi</value>
</enum>
<enum name= 'capsType' />
<enum name= 'pciBackend' >
<value > default</value>
<value > vfio</value>
</enum>
</hostdev>
<rng supported= 'yes' >
<enum name= 'model' >
<value > virtio</value>
<value > virtio-transitional</value>
<value > virtio-non-transitional</value>
</enum>
<enum name= 'backendModel' >
<value > random</value>
<value > egd</value>
<value > builtin</value>
</enum>
</rng>
</devices>
<features >
<gic supported= 'no' />
<vmcoreinfo supported= 'yes' />
<genid supported= 'yes' />
<backingStoreInput supported= 'yes' />
<backup supported= 'no' />
<sev supported= 'no' />
</features>
</domainCapabilities>